Description

Employing a multi-disciplinary team, this project will analyze data provided by the LSU WaTCH investigators using an ecological bio-behavioral stress model that explores the complex paths from exposure to dysfunction among Gulf Coast children exposed to the Deepwater Horizon oil spill.

The overall goals of this project are to: (1) understand the short- and longer-term impacts of the oil spill on children’s development and well-being; and (2) examine how parental and social forces, and alternative treatment models can mediate or modify the spill’s effects on children.
